#3bb020 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#3bb020 is composed of 23.1% red, 69% green and 12.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 66.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 81.8% yellow and 31% black. It has a hue angle of 108.8 degrees, a saturation of 69.2% and a lightness of 40.8%. #3bb020 color hex could be obtained by blending #76ff40 with #006100. Closest websafe color is: #339933.

Shades and Tints of #3bb020

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030a02 is the darkest color, while #f9fef8 is the lightest one.
